| | | | | | We Grind Our Whole Wheat Fresh Everyday! | No one else does it, but we go the extra mile. Because freshly milled whole wheat tastes phenomenal, and fresh whole grain bread is life-enhancing. We use premium wheat bought from family owned farms located in the finest wheat growing region in the world -- Montana. And we only use pure and simple ingredients in our products. You won’t find additives, preservatives or any ingredients you can’t pronounce.
